Webscoff From Longman Dictionary of Contemporary English scoff /skɒf $ skɒːf, skɑːf/ verb 1 [ intransitive, transitive] to laugh at a person or idea, and talk about them in a way that shows you think they are stupid scoff at David scoffed at her fears. Officials scoffed at the idea. Webskof, skof'-er: The verb indicates the manifestation of contempt by insulting words or actions; it combines bitterness with ridicule.

WebTo scoff is to express insolent doubt or derision, openly and emphatically: to scoff at a new invention.
